 Nigeria owes 46.25 trillion in debt. - DMO


According to the Nigerian Debt Management Office, by the month of Dismantlement 2022, the nation's debt will total N46.25 trillion.

He said that seven trillion dollars were added to the nation's obligations, according to a statement released by the Office on Thursday.

According to the DMO, the federal and state governments' use of fresh loans to finance large-scale projects and close budget gaps is to blame for the rising level of debt.

According to the office, the government's initiatives to boost revenue from the non-oil and oil sectors will make it possible to complete projects without taking on debt.

Nigerians are still visibly concerned about the nation's debt load.

The nation and the Paris Club came to a debt reduction arrangement in 2005, which allowed the nation to have 18 billion dollars of its debt forgiven.
